A basic script for uninstalling a list of app packages in Windows 10/11, including those pre-installed with Windows
# A basic script for uninstalling app packages in Windows 10/11, including those pre-installed with Windows
#
# Note: If you get an error about the script not being allowed to run, the below command will change the execution polciy temporarily for one session only:
# Set-ExecutionPolicy -ExecutionPolicy RemoteSigned -Scope Process
#
# To execute the script, open a Powershell window to the directory with the script and run the following command using your scripts file name (and don't forget the .\ )
# .\WhateverScriptName.ps1

Problem

I have two Github accounts: oanhnn (personal) and superman (for work). I want to use both accounts on same computer (without typing password everytime, when doing git push or pull).

Solution

Use ssh keys and define host aliases in ssh config file (each alias for an account).

How to?

  1. Generate ssh key pairs for accounts and add them to GitHub accounts.
